OMGD Malaysia Dinner

Bailliage of Malaysia
Kuala Lumpur, August 29, 2023

A unique event
" The National Bailliage celebrated the 60th Anniversary of the International Ordre Mondial des Gourmets Dégustateurs (OMGD) "

The National Bailliage celebrated the 60th Anniversary of the International Ordre Mondial des Gourmets Dégustateurs (OMGD) with a special Michelin 2-star dinner by renowned chef Alberto Landgraf from Rio de Janeiro.

This exclusive event was hosted at eye-popping Sky51 with unrivalled views at the top of Officier Maître Hotelier Donald Lim’s establishment, EQ Kuala Lumpur (KL). EQ KL was winner of Travel and Leisure Awards Asia Pacific in 2022 and 2023 for being the number one hotel in Malaysia. Conseiller Culinaire Federico Michieletto is EQ KL’s Executive Chef.

Members and guests enjoyed blue cocktails, mocktails and canapés at Blue, KL’s top rooftop lounge. A group photo in front of a stunning backdrop of Christ the Redeemer looking over Rio de Janeiro was a no brainer! We then moved for dinner to Sabayon with its panoramic view of KL’s cityscape. Copper and bronze tones accented dramatic high ceilings.

Everyone was enchanted by an unforgettable culinary journey. We tasted, savoured and relished the best of Brazilian Rio gastronomy. Many ingredients were especially flown in from Brazil. The exquisite dinner was presented with Japanese culinary artistry and paired with amazing wines from Alsace, Bordeaux, Burgundy, Champagne and Italy’s Friuli-Venezia Giulia.

Master of Ceremonies was Échanson Olivier di Tullio. He also conducted the evening’s auctions, proceeds of which have been earmarked for the Bailliage of Malaysia’s Jeunes Sommeliers Competition programme.

The auction’s star item was an incredible painting generously donated by award winning Dato Chng Huck Theng. An artist and sculptor on the local and international stage he draws inspiration from acute observations of the correlation between human, nature and society. Chng’s talents as an artist cover not only painting and contemporary Chinese calligraphy. His bronze sculptures are internationally acclaimed and have been auctioned in Singapore and Malaysia.

Traditional gifts to the ladies were sponsored by Chargé de Missions Paul Lau, elder son of Dato’ Lau Foo Sun, the National Bailliage’s founder.

Post dinner, the evening’s camaraderie continued well into the early hours at the VIP Sky Deck. Its open-air rooftop bar was reserved for Chaîne members and guests.

Truly a magical evening with plenty of camaraderie, joy and laughter to accompany a dinner extraordinaire. Many happy memories of a unique event for those who were lucky to attend!
